Cold waves swept Punjab, Haryana and Chandigarh with minimum temperatures hovering several notches below normal even as fog reduced visibility this morning at some places.

Freezing cold swept Amritsar, which recorded a below normal low of 0.8 degrees celsius.

Ludhiana and Patiala, too, experienced the chill recording respective lows of 5.8 degrees celsius and 5.6 degrees celsius, the MeT office said here on Thursday.

Hisar, Bhiwani and Narnaul in Haryana reeled under extreme cold recording minimum temperature of 1 degrees celsius each.

Karnal had a cold night at 3.4 degrees celsius, while Ambala recorded a low of 5.8 degrees celsius.

Chandigarh, too, had a cold night at 5.6 degrees celsius. According to the MeT, fog reduced visibility this morning at places including Chandigarh, Hisar and Karnal.

There would be no immediate relief from the biting cold over the next few days, the MeT said.
